[docs]def test_config_minimize_ref_properties1(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"required": [], # all properties optional
"properties:": {
"a_ref": 1,
"b": 2
}
})
# a_ref optional, so it is always omitted
assert "a_ref" not in value
assert "b" in value or not value
[docs]def test_config_minimize_ref_properties2(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"required": ["a_ref"],
"properties": {
"a_ref": 1,
"b": 2
}
})
# a_ref required, so it is always present, even though we are
# trying to minimize ref properties.
assert "a_ref" in value
[docs]def test_config_minimize_ref_properties3(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b_ref"]
},
"one": ["group"]
},
"required": [],
"properties": {
"a_ref": 1,
"b_ref": 2,
"c": 3
}
})
# presence co-constraint group "group" can't be satisfied with non-ref
# properties, and it is optional, so the whole group is always omitted
assert "a_ref" not in value and "b_ref" not in value
[docs]def test_config_minimize_ref_properties4(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b_ref"]
},
"one": ["group"]
},
"required": ["group"],
"properties": {
"a_ref": 1,
"b_ref": 2,
"c": 3
}
})
# presence co-constraint group "group" can't be satisfied with non-ref
# properties, but it's required, so one of the ref properties must be
# there.
assert "a_ref" in value or "b_ref" in value
[docs]def test_config_minimize_ref_properties5(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b_ref"]
},
"at-least-one": ["group"]
},
"required": ["group"],
"properties": {
"a_ref": 1,
"b_ref": 2,
"c": 3
}
})
# presence co-constraint group "group" can't be satisfied with non-ref
# properties, but it's required. In this case, the constraint says
# we can choose more than one from the group, but when minimizing
# reference properties, we never choose more than one. In this
# situation, "at-least-one" behaves exactly the same as "one".
assert "a_ref" in value or "b_ref" in value
assert "a_ref" not in value or "b_ref" not in value
[docs]def test_config_minimize_ref_properties6(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b_ref"]
},
"all": ["group"]
},
"required": ["group"],
"properties": {
"a_ref": 1,
"b_ref": 2,
"c": 3
}
})
# presence co-constraint group "group" can't be satisfied with non-ref
# properties, but it's required. Since it's an "all" group, both ref
# properties must always be present
assert "a_ref" in value and "b_ref" in value
[docs]def test_config_minimize_ref_properties7(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b"]
},
"one": ["group"]
},
"required": ["group"],
"properties": {
"a_ref": 1,
"b": 2,
"c": 3
}
})
# presence co-constraint group "group" can be satisfied with non-ref
# properties, and it is required, so the non-ref property must always
# be chosen as the satisfying property. So "a_ref" will never appear
# and "b" will always appear.
assert "a_ref" not in value and "b" in value
[docs]def test_config_minimize_ref_properties8(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b"]
},
"at-least-one": ["group"]
},
"required": ["group"],
"properties": {
"a_ref": 1,
"b": 2,
"c": 3
}
})
# Same as prev test, but with at-least-one co-constraint:
# presence co-constraint group "group" can be satisfied with non-ref
# properties, and it is required, so the non-ref property must always
# be chosen as the satisfying property. So "a_ref" will never appear
# and "b" will always appear.
assert "a_ref" not in value and "b" in value
[docs]def test_config_minimize_ref_properties9(num_trials):
config = stix2generator.generation.object_generator.Config(
minimize_ref_properties=True,
optional_property_probability=1
)
generator = stix2generator.generation.object_generator.ObjectGenerator(
config=config
)
for _ in range(num_trials):
value = generator.generate_from_spec({
"type": "object",
"presence-coconstraints": {
"property-groups": {
"group": ["a_ref", "b_refs"]
},
"all": ["group"]
},
"required": [],
"properties": {
"a_ref": 1,
"b_refs": 2,
"c": 3
}
})
# There is a conflict in the settings: optional_property_probability=1
# means always include optional properties, and group "group" is
# optional. But it can't be satisfied with non-ref properties, so
# minimize_ref_properties takes priority and the group is always
# omitted.
assert "a_ref" not in value and "b_refs" not in value
